Abstract
Flame detecting apparatus is disclosed for detecting the presence of ultraviolet radiation indicating the presence of a fire. The apparatus itself includes a housing with at least one aperture, an alarm and a UV detector extending through the aperture for triggering the alarm, and protective wings disposed about the aperture to protect the UV detector without blocking same from the ultraviolet radiation.
